BOSMAN, J. The art and science of dense medium selection. J. S. Afr. Inst. Min. Metall. [online]. 2014, vol.114, n.7, pp.529-536. ISSN 2411-9717.

Medium suspensions play an integral part in the successful application of dense medium separation for both static and dynamic separators. Although models exist to predict particle movement as a function of medium density and viscosity, these models have been derived on the assumption of Newtonian rheology. Viscosity measurements of medium suspensions have shown that they are non-Newtonian, with a yield stress, and as such cannot be used in the existing models. As a result, medium selection remains an art based upon practical experience and indirect measurements of viscosity such as stability and cyclone differentials.

Keywords : DMS medium; rheology; dense medium drum; dense medium cyclone.
